Output 268e4214594a825a07a38d03e26204487cb08bbd6c4fec14b0d49214ce7a2521:0

value
268818254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ee646286b8e7aff51221096f2c9f4b8326c96acc OP_EQUAL
address
3PRX14Zsotfy9zZPBJmbNcCjz9YsRtsJTN
transaction
268e4214594a825a07a38d03e26204487cb08bbd6c4fec14b0d49214ce7a2521
confirmations
536997
spent
true